Design of an Axially Chiral Dicarboxylic Acid and Its Application in Syntheses of Optically Active β-Amino Acids and β-Amino Phosphonic Acid Derivatives

Abstract

An axially chiral dicarboxylic acid was developed as a new chiral Brønsted acid catalyst. With this novel catalyst in hand, N-Boc-protected β-amino acids or β-amino phosphonic acid derivatives could be obtained in high yields and enantioselectivities by asymmetric Mannich-type reaction of N-Boc imines and diazo compounds.
